Typical Sources Of Porosity

Contamination, in the kind of dirt, grease, or rust on the welding surface area, develops gas pockets when heated, leading to porosity in the weld. Incorrect shielding happens when the protecting gas, generally utilized in processes like MIG and TIG welding, is incapable to fully protect the liquified weld swimming pool from responding with the bordering air, resulting in gas entrapment and subsequent porosity. Furthermore, insufficient gas coverage, usually due to incorrect circulation prices or nozzle positioning, can leave components of the weld vulnerable, allowing porosity to develop.

Effects on Weld High Quality

The presence of porosity in a weld can considerably compromise the overall top quality and stability of the welded joint. Porosity within a weld creates spaces or tooth cavities that damage the structure, making it much more vulnerable to breaking, rust, and mechanical failure.

Furthermore, porosity can impede the efficiency of non-destructive screening (NDT) strategies, making it testing to identify other issues or stoppages within the weld. This can bring about significant security issues, particularly in vital applications where the structural stability of the bonded elements is vital.

Prevention Techniques Review

Given the harmful effect of porosity on weld high quality, effective prevention techniques are vital to maintaining the structural honesty of bonded joints. Among the main prevention techniques is comprehensive cleaning of the base materials prior to welding. Contaminants such as oil, grease, corrosion, and moisture can add to porosity, so making certain a clean work surface area is important. Proper storage space of welding consumables in dry problems is likewise vital to stop dampness absorption, which can cause gas entrapment during welding. Additionally, picking the appropriate welding criteria, such as voltage, present, and travel speed, can aid minimize the danger of porosity formation. Making certain adequate securing gas flow and insurance coverage is one more important avoidance method, as insufficient gas coverage can lead to atmospheric contamination and porosity. Finally, appropriate welder training and qualification are important for executing preventive measures efficiently and consistently. By including these avoidance strategies into welding methods, the occurrence of porosity can be significantly minimized, causing stronger and more reputable bonded joints.
